Frequently Asked Questions About Substance Abuse Treatment in Fort Thompson, SD

What types of substance abuse treatment programs are available in Fort Thompson, SD?

In Fort Thompson, SD, you can find various substance abuse treatment programs, including inpatient rehab, outpatient programs, detoxification, and support groups. The choice depends on the individual's needs and severity of addiction.

How do I determine if I or a loved one needs substance abuse treatment?

Recognizing the need for substance abuse treatment involves assessing behavioral changes, increased tolerance, withdrawal symptoms, and a loss of control over substance use. Consultation with a healthcare professional can provide a definitive diagnosis.

What are the common therapies used in substance abuse treatment?

Common therapies include c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), individual counseling, group therapy, family therapy, and motivational enhancement therapy. Treatment plans are tailored to the individual's needs and may include a combination of these approaches.

What aftercare options are available following substance abuse treatment in Fort Thompson, SD?

Aftercare options in Fort Thompson, SD may include ongoing counseling, support groups, alumni programs, and sober living arrangements. Aftercare is crucial for maintaining sobriety and preventing relapse.

How can I find a reputable substance abuse treatment center in Fort Thompson, SD?

To find a reputable treatment center, research online reviews and ratings, ask for recommendations from healthcare professionals, check accreditation and licensing, and inquire about the center's approach to treatment and success rates. It's essential to choose a facility that aligns with your specific needs and goals.
